actually there not, i talked to avelectronics and what there doing is tapping into the video line and simply overriding the screen as soon as you turn on there little power switch, and all your factory things such as (navigation) are still runnin in the background - BUT ILL TAKE YOUR 10-1 ODDS
Wow I stand corrected, so they are basically bypassing everything and just overlaying the video on top of the current signal so it shows....very interesting..
Not a single 2005 Chrysler NAV unit has been modded to play DVDs from its DVD slot. They all require usage of an extrernal DVD player mounted in the trunk or center console.
